Makro gesucht: Bearbeitungszeit über viele Dateien

Hallo,

Word speichert bei jedem Dokument die Bearbeitungszeit („editing time“) (das kann man ein- und ausschalten – bei mir ist es eingeschaltet). Könnte mir jemand von euch evtl. bei folgendem Problem helfen:

Ich habe eine Reihe von Dateien, alle mit dem Dateinamenformat Diss_v999.doc, wobei 999 jeweils Zahlen sind (also z.B. 001, 002,…, 420 – ach ja, es fängt zweistellig an, aber die Dateinamen ändere ich notfalls). Es gibt aber nicht alle (also z.B. nach 312 könnte 400 kommen).

Ich würde gerne für alle diese Dateien die jeweiligen Bearbeitungszeiten auslesen. Geht sowas? Das wäre wirklich genial!

Minimalanforderung wäre die Zeiten aller Dateien im Verzeichnis ausgegeben zu bekommen, die Zuordnung zu bestimmten Dateien ist unwichtig. Noch besser wäre (aber das nur, wenn es einfach ist), wenn der Dateiname und das letzte Speicherdatum noch mit dabei wäre, und das Bonbon wäre noch die jeweilige Wortzahl der Dateien.

Mich interessiert hauptsächlich die Gesamtzeit, die an diesen Dokumenten gearbeitet worden ist. Der Rest aus dem letzten Absatz wäre Spielerei, aber wenn das einfach möglich ist…

Habt ihr eventuell eine Idee?

Viele Grüße, herzlichen Dank,

Dennis

Hallo Dennis,

das ganze habe ich mal für PPT-Dateien gemacht. das Keywort was Du suchst ist BuiltinDocumentProperties. Eventuell können Dir folgende Seiten erstmal weiterhelfen.

http://www.pbugg.de/pbforum/viewtopic.php?p=2020&sid…
https://www.mcseboard.de/windows-forum-allgemein-28/…

MfG Georg V.

[Bei dieser Antwort wurde das Vollzitat nachträglich automatisiert entfernt]

Danke!
Hallo,

vielen Dank! Dank der Hinweise habe ich einen Weg gefunden, funktioniert super:

http://word.mvps.org/FAQS/MacrosVBA/DSOFile.htm

Viele Grüße

Dennis